Registration for Pennsylvania Mother's Day benefit convoy opens

The 2023 Mother's Day Truck Convoy and Carnival will take place on the grounds of the Manheim Pennsylvania Auto Auction on Mother’s Day, May 14. 

Drivers can now register to participate in this year’s convoy and fundraising efforts. There is no fee to register, but drivers must raise a minimum of $100 to be able to drive in the convoy.

The convoy is the largest fundraiser for the Make-A-Wish Philadelphia, Delaware & Susquehanna Valley chapter, raising the funds needed to grant 75% of the annual wishes in the region. Last year, the convoy raised upwards of $500,000. The goal for this year’s event is $700,000.

The group anticipates having up to 500 drivers representing hundreds of trucking companies at this year's convoy.

In this year’s convoy, the first 30 trucks that will kick off the 26-mile route are the top 30 fundraisers from 2022. These individuals receive VIP treatment and recognition throughout the year and collectively raised more than $300,000 for Make-A-Wish in 2022. After the 2023 Convoy Fundraising Campaign concludes on June 18, the top 30 drivers for the 2024 convoy will be confirmed.

These drivers will be invited to a special Convoy Celebration in August or September to announce their rank in the top 30 and celebrate their success. This tradition of celebrating the top 30 fundraisers at the Mother’s Day Truck Convoy began very early in the event’s history.

Every driver that raises at least $1,000 but does not qualify in the top 30 earns the Grand Driver title. These individuals get a prime spot in the convoy and receive special recognition at the Convoy Celebration event.
